本文目录导读:
图片来源于网络,如有侵权联系删除
在信息化时代,数据已成为企业、组织乃至个人不可或缺的资产,为了更好地挖掘和利用这些数据,数据仓库和数据库技术应运而生,OLAP(Online Analytical Processing,在线分析处理)这一概念,却让人产生了疑惑:OLAP究竟是数据库,还是数据仓库?本文将深入探讨OLAP的本质,揭开其既是数据库又是数据仓库的神秘面纱。
OLAP的定义与特点
1、定义
OLAP是一种用于对大量数据进行快速、复杂查询和分析的技术,它能够帮助用户从多个角度、多层次地观察数据,从而发现数据中的规律和趋势,OLAP的核心是多维数据模型,通过多维立方体(Cube)等数据结构,实现对数据的快速查询和分析。
2、特点
(1)多维性:OLAP能够从多个维度对数据进行观察和分析,如时间、地区、产品等。
(2)切片和切块:用户可以根据需求对数据立方体进行切片和切块,以便从不同角度观察数据。
(3)钻取和卷起:钻取(Drill-Down)是指从低层次数据向高层次数据的转换,卷起(Roll-Up)则相反。
(4)多维计算:OLAP支持多维计算,如求和、平均、最大值、最小值等。
OLAP与数据库的关系
1、数据库是OLAP的基础
数据库是存储和管理数据的系统,为OLAP提供数据源,在OLAP系统中,数据通常来源于关系数据库、数据仓库等。
图片来源于网络,如有侵权联系删除
2、OLAP对数据库的要求
(1)数据质量:为了保证OLAP分析结果的准确性,数据库中的数据必须准确、完整、一致。
(2)性能:数据库应具备良好的查询性能,以满足OLAP快速查询的需求。
(3)扩展性:数据库应具备良好的扩展性,以适应数据量的增长。
OLAP与数据仓库的关系
1、数据仓库是OLAP的数据源
数据仓库是一个集成的、面向主题的、非易失的数据集合,用于支持企业的决策过程,OLAP从数据仓库中提取数据进行分析。
2、OLAP与数据仓库的协同作用
(1)数据仓库为OLAP提供稳定、可靠的数据源。
(2)OLAP对数据仓库中的数据进行深度挖掘,为企业提供决策支持。
(3)数据仓库与OLAP的协同作用,有助于提高企业的数据利用效率。
图片来源于网络,如有侵权联系删除
OLAP既是数据库又是数据仓库的原因
1、数据来源
OLAP的数据来源既可以是数据库,也可以是数据仓库,这取决于企业的具体需求和实施策略。
2、数据结构
OLAP的数据结构既可以是关系型数据库,也可以是多维数据模型,这取决于企业的技术选型和业务需求。
3、功能
OLAP的功能既包括数据库的基本功能,如数据存储、查询、维护等,也包括数据仓库的高级功能,如多维分析、数据挖掘等。
OLAP既是数据库又是数据仓库,它既是数据存储和管理的工具,也是数据分析和挖掘的平台,在信息化时代,OLAP在帮助企业挖掘数据价值、提高决策效率方面发挥着重要作用,了解OLAP的本质,有助于企业更好地利用数据,实现业务创新和发展。
标签: #olap是数据库还是数据仓库吗
评论列表